Warwick Conferences to invest £5.3m in new meeting venue


Warwick Conferences has unveiled plans to invest £5.3m in opening a fourth dedicated meeting venue on the University of Warwick campus in Coventry and Warwickshire

The new venue – which will open in September 2016 – will offer 650 square metres of contemporary and highly flexible event space from a brand new stand alone facility adjacent to two of Warwick Conferences’ existing training and conference venues..

With a single flat-floor space capacity of 350 seated, expansive ceiling height and reinforced flooring, the venue offers bookers a completely new option in Warwickshire and the West Midlands, and extends Warwick Conferences’ capability significantly.
